Analysis
Asia recorded 67.74 million t for other forest — burning crop residues in 2024.
Compared with earlier readings it is down 14.7% on the previous year and down 30.8% over ten years.
Over the whole period, other forest — burning crop residues in Asia peaked at 160.92 million t in 2004 and was at its lowest, 31.71 million t, in 1996.
Asia ranks 2nd of 22 groups on this measure, in the top 10%.
The long-run direction has been consistently rising across the 35 years of available data.

About this data
The FAOSTAT domain on Emissions from Fires consists of estimates of methane (CH4), nitrous oxide (N2O) and carbon dioxide (CO2) emissions generated from biomass burning in a range of vegetation types and from fires in organic soils.
